    Carroll had a pretty solid year for the Crew. Unfortunately he's going to be remembered for the missed penalty kick that ended the playoffs for us, but he did a lot of good stuff during a tough season. He's a dependable, veteran DM who's not going to make any big errors and will be able to help the backs who, looking at the names on this roster, are going to need some veteran help. Gaven and Rogers are definitely there for Bob Bradley to get a good look at for possible selection for rosters in upcoming tournaments and WC qualifiers. Robbie's still coming back from his knee surgery, but he did well in his games at the end of the year, including scoring a nice goal in the playoffs. At first I was kind of surprised BC got the call, but the more I think about it, the more sense it makes. The NT's central midfield is pretty much set for big competitions in the future, so giving a respected guy like BC a run out in the US shirt makes sense, I think. (Plus he's a favorite of Crew supporters so I'm extremely happy for him. :))

    I'm interested in seeing how Tim Ream does. He had a good year and he could develop into a solid back for the nats, which is needed. I'm excited to see Lichaj get another shot, and I'm expecting Gaven to do well.
